SpiffyTitles
Displays link titles when posted in a channel. This plugin has the following goals:
-
Extreme reliability and in the case of failure, robust error reporting to ease debugging. Errors are logged.
-
The ability to customize features that could conceivably need to change (within reason)
Using SpiffyTitles
- You should
unloadthe Web plugin and any other plugins that show link titles for best results
To unload the Web plugin:
!unload Web
Load SpiffyTitles:
!load SpiffyTitles
Available Options
defaultTitleTemplate - This is the template used when showing the title of a link.
Default value: ^ {{title}}
Example output:
^ Google.com
youtubeTitleTemplate - This is the template used when showing the title of a YouTube video
Default value: ^ {{title}} :: Duration: {{duration}} :: Views: {{view_count}} :: Rating: {{rating}}
Example output:
^ Snoop Dogg - Pump Pump feat. Lil Malik :: Duration: 00:04:41 :: Views: 189,120 :: Rating: 4.82
imgurTemplate - This is the template used when showing information about an imgur link.
Default value: ^ {%if title %}{{title}} :: {% endif %}{{type}} {{width}}x{{height}} {{file_size}} :: {{view_count}} views :: {%if nsfw == None %}not sure{% elif nsfw == True %}NSFW{% else %}safe for work {% endif %}
Example output:
^ You know what time it is? :: image/jpeg 500x667 63.3KiB :: 82,892 views :: safe for work
Notes on the imgur handler:
- You'll need a register an application with imgur
- Select "OAuth 2 authorization without a callback URL"
- If there is a problem reaching the API the default handler will be used as a fallback. See logs for details.
- The API seems to report information on the originally uploaded image and not other formats
useBold - Whether to bold the title. Default value: False
cooldownInSeconds - Only show the title of the same URL every X seconds. This setting prevents the
bot from spamming the channel if the same link is posted multiple times quickly. Default value: 5
channelWhitelist - a comma separated list of channels in which titles should be displayed. If "",
titles will be shown in all channels. Default value: ""
channelBlacklist - a comma separated list of channels in which titles should never be displayed. If "",
titles will be shown in all channels. Default value: ""
About white/black lists
- If
channelWhitelistandchannelBlacklistare empty, then titles will be displayed in every channel - If
channelBlacklisthas #foo, then titles will be displayed in every channel except #foo - If
channelWhitelisthas #foo thenchannelBlacklistwill be ignored
Examples
Show titles in every channel except #foo
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.channelBlacklist #foo
Only show titles in #bar
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.channelWhitelist #bar
Only show titles in #baz and #bar
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.channelWhitelist #baz,#bar
Remove channel whitelist
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.channelWhitelist ""
ignoredDomainPattern - ignore domains matching this pattern. Default value: ""
Tip
You can ignore domains that you know aren't websites. This prevents a request from being made at all.
Examples
Ignore all links with the domain i.imgur.com
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.ignoredDomainPattern (i\.imgur\.com)
Ignore *.tk and i.imgur.com
!config supybot.plugins.SpiffyTitles.ignoredDomainPattern (\.tk|i\.imgur\.com)
userAgents - A comma separated list of strings of user agents randomly chosen when requesting.
urlRegularExpression - A regular expression used to match URLs. You shouldn't need to change this.
FAQ
Q: Why not use the Web plugin?
A: My experience was that it didn't work very well and lacked the ability to customize the options I wanted to change.
Q: What about Supybot-Titler ?
A: I couldn't get this to work on my system and it has a lot of features I didn't want
Q: It doesn't work for me. What can I do?
A: Open an issue and include at minimum the following:
- Brief description of the problem
- Any errors that were logged (Look for the ones prefixed "SpiffyTitles")
- How to reproduce the effect
- Any other information you think would be helpful
